CON HOLD in Hinckley and Bosworth
Follow here for live updates on the general election results in Hinckley and Bosworth.
Dr Luke Evans, of the Conservative Party, was elected as Member of Parliament for Hinckley and Bosworth
Results
Candidate: CHESHIRE Peter Alan
Party: Reform UK
Votes: 8,817
Candidate: EVANS Dr Luke
Party: The Conservative Party Candidate
Votes: 17,032
Candidate: MASTERS Harry
Party: Independent
Votes: 211
Candidate: MULLANEY Michael Timothy
Party: Liberal Democrats - For a fair deal
Votes: 11,624
Candidate: PAWLEY Rebecca
Party: Labour Party
Votes: 8,601
Candidate: WELLS Cassie
Party: The Green Party Votes: 1,514
Ballot papers issued 47,968
